Sanglinsi in Bainang County, Shigatse

Chinese Name: 白朗县桑林寺
English Name: Sanglin Monastery
Location: Located at mount Zhazeng(查增山), 500 meters in the west of Sanglin Village(桑林村) in Bainang County, Shigatse

Sanglin Monastery is located at mount Zhazeng(查增山), 500 meters in the west of Sanglin Village(桑林村) in Bainang County, with an elevation of 4214 meters. The temple was founded in 1190 by Ewa Quduo(俄瓦曲多), a sect of Geju(噶举派).

The original building covered an area of 12,000 square meters, seating on the east side facing the west, and mainly consisting of the halls, the Buddhist temple, the temple of protection, the kitchen, and the monk’s house. The buildings were destroyed during the Great Cultural Revolution and was later rebuilt on the original site in 1988. It is now composed of the main hall and the pagoda. Sanglin Monastery has a long history, only 30 meters from Sanglin Monastery to Puqu River in the south, Kading Mountain(卡定山) is lying in the north, Esa Mountain(俄萨山) lying in the west.

Before sun rising every day, the graceful outline of the terraces had been looming in the early morning light, and stood at the top of the monastery, looking down, the scenery is just like an elegant ink painting. When the sun rises from the east, the red light is projected on the village nearby, meanwhile with the rise of the sun the color of surrounding changes a lot.
